Wood: A Classic Choice
Wood is a popular material for gates and fences due to its natural beauty and durability. There are several types of wood to choose from, including:
- Pressure-Treated Wood: A cost-effective option that is resistant to rot and insect damage.
- Cedar Wood: A durable and rot-resistant option that also repels insects.
- Redwood: A premium option that is naturally resistant to decay and insect damage.
Metal: Strength and Security
Metal gates and fences are known for their strength and security. They are available in various materials, including:
- Aluminum: A lightweight and corrosion-resistant option that is ideal for coastal areas.
- Steel: A durable and secure option that is often used for industrial and commercial applications.
- Wrought Iron: A classic option that is known for its beauty and strength.
Vinyl: A Low-Maintenance Option
Vinyl gates and fences are a popular choice for homeowners who want a low-maintenance option. They are available in various colors and styles, including:
- Vinyl Coated Steel: A durable and corrosion-resistant option that is ideal for harsh weather conditions.
- PVC Vinyl: A low-maintenance option that is resistant to rot, decay, and insect damage.
Composite: A Sustainable Option
Composite gates and fences are made from a combination of materials, including wood fibers and plastic. They are a sustainable option that is resistant to rot, decay, and insect damage.
